It's been a historic year in Seattle politics, with a first-ever recall election involving a city council member, the first woman ever elected city attorney, and the first Asian American ever elected mayor. Our panel of seasoned reporters reflects on the biggest headlines of 2021, the escalating homelessness crisis, and a power struggle brewing inside city hall.
Guests:
Essex Porter, Senior Political Reporter, KIRO TV (retired)
Amy Radil, Reporter, KUOW-FM
Kevin Schofield, Founder, Seattle City Council Insight
Michael Creel & Yong Hong Wang, Co-Owners, Seven Stars Pepper Szechuan Restaurant
